Who are the main characters in Thornton W Burgess Bedtime Stories?
Peter Rabbit is a main character. He is a young and curious rabbit who often explores the forest and gets into trouble. Then there's Grandfather Frog, an old and wise amphibian who imparts knowledge to the other animals. Also, Sammy Jay, the blue jay, is quite prominent with his inquisitive nature.

Who are the popular animal characters in Thornton Burgess Animal Stories?
One popular character is Sammy Jay, the blue jay. He is known for his noisy and sometimes mischievous nature. Another is Reddy Fox, who is often up to no good, trying to catch the smaller animals for his meal but usually getting outwitted in the end.

What are some books similar to Thornton Burgess Animal Stories?
One book similar is 'The Wind in the Willows' by Kenneth Grahame. It features animal characters like Mole, Rat, Toad, and Badger, and just like Thornton Burgess' works, it has charming stories about the animal world and their adventures. Another could be 'Charlotte's Web' by E. B. White. It tells the story of a pig and a spider, with themes of friendship and the cycle of life that are also present in Burgess' stories. A third one is 'Watership Down' by Richard Adams. This book focuses on a group of rabbits and their journey, and it has elements of animal behavior, survival, and community, much like Thornton Burgess Animal Stories.
